Wood from ash trees killed by the Emerald Ash Borer has been transformed into innovative products thanks to a design competition organized by Ontario Wood, the City of Toronto and IIDEXCanada. More than a dozen products created from Toronto’s untapped ash wood resource are on display this week at the IIDEX Woodshop. Products range from outdoor lounge chairs to toy building blocks to wall-mounted bicycle stands. Guild Park was among the places ravaged by this invasive insect. About 3,000 ash trees were cut down in Guild Park due to a combination of the Emerald Ash Borer and damage from the 2014 ice storm. An estimated 200,000 ash trees across the city will be lost in the next 5 years due to this infestation . This year's "Woodshop aims to reduce the number of ash trees headed for the landfill by creating innovative, market-ready commercial and consumer prototypes," according to event organizers. The IIDEX Woodshop runs from today (Jan 18) through Sunday Jan 24 at the main Rotunda at Toronto City Hall, 100 Queen Street West. Admission is free. An on-line article describes the recent work done at Guild Park to prepare its facilities for the return of arts and culture actives. The information comes from the City of Toronto's Museums & Heritage Services. It tells about creating the new Monument Walk at Guild Park, a project that involved repositioning 19 architectural artifacts and sculptures originally collected by the site owners, Rosa and Spencer Clark. The on-line story also describes the major remedial work done inside the park's "Building 191" (the office building used by the Clarks), and the site's two log cabins, one of which is more than 150 years old. The photo from the City of Toronto shows two staffers wearing protective "Haz-Mat" suits while doing this work. "Museums & Heritage Services has also been responsible for the environmental abatement of the three heritage buildings at the Guild. The two cabins had been home to generations of wildlife; while there was no led or asbestos, the interiors were equally hazardous," states the article. "Building 191 was a much greater challenge. Full of furniture, decorative arts and ephemera, everything had to be sorted. Materials to be salvaged were cleaned, packed and moved to the Museums & Heritage Services collections facility.... All three buildings are now safe and ready to be improved for new uses." The revitalization at Guild Park was selected as one of the Scarborough Mirror’s “10 Stories That Changed Scarborough In 2015.” Reporter Mike Adler noted how the redevelopment partnership for the old Guild Inn site was formalized between the City of Toronto and Dynamic Hospitality and Entertainment. He also commented that the City seems prepared to invest millions of public funds to upgrade Guild Park and has begun public consultations about bringing arts facilities back to the site. “Former owners [of the Guild Inn property] Rosa and Spencer Clark would be proud,” wrote Adler. Other Scarborough stories making the Top 10 list for 2015 include: • the call to create a new and unified hospital for Scarborough; • the “community renewal campaign” for Scarborough, launched by local Rotary clubs; • work on the Scarborough Subway; • the successful Pan Am Games and its lasting legacy to Scarborough – the new Sports Centre; • TamilFest 2015, which celebrated the role of Scarborough’s Tamil community; and • The expected go-ahead of an expanded National Urban Rouge Park. The new year is a good time to remember Spencer Clark's appointment to the Order of Canada a generation ago. The major role that Spencer and his wife, Rosa, played on the art and architecture sector of Toronto and all of Canada has become less appreciated over the years. In 1932, the couple founded the Guild of All Arts on their property, which is now known as Guild Park & Gardens.. After opening their home as a haven to Canadian creators, the Clarks established the Guild Inn and later the Guildwood Village community. For these and other life-long endeavours, Spencer was awarded the Order of Canada in December 1983, about two years after Rosa's death. The accompanying photo of Spencer (Getty Images) was taken in the 1980s. The setting is in front of one of the building facades preserved by the Clarks and which remains on public view at Guild Park today.. Below is Spencer's brief bio that accompanied the national honour of becoming a Member of the Order of Canada:: "H. Spencer Clark, CM, BASc, MRAIC - An engineer who developed broad interests in history, he became a patron of the arts and crafts and a force in historical preservation. "In 1932 he and his wife founded the Guild of All Arts at Scarborough, Ontario, which supported artists and crafts people in difficult times. By the 1950s he was rescuing elements from Toronto architecture under demolition and re-erecting them at the Guild. "He has also helped to save Sibbald Park on Lake Simcoe, the Musical Ride of the RCMP and the covered bridge in Hartland, New Brunswick."
